Revenue and income statement
In 2024, SIOEN FRANCE achieves revenue of 45.6 M€. Over the period 2016-2024, the company shows strong growth with a CAGR (compound annual growth rate) of +8.1%. Vs 2023, growth of +14% (39.9 M€ -> 45.6 M€). After deducting consumption (37.7 M€), gross margin stands at 7.9 M€, i.e. a rate of 17%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ches 3.1 M€, representing 6.7% of revenue. The operating margin remains fragile, requiring cost vigilance. Ultimately, net income (= EBIT +/- financial result +/- exceptional - corporate tax) amounts to 2.4 M€, i.e. 5.3% of revenue. This profit can be retained or distributed to shareholders.

Solvency and debt ratios
The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 60%. Debt remains under control: the company retains capacity to raise new debt if needed.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 32%. The balance between equity and debt is satisfactory. Debt repayment capacity (= Financial debt / Cash flow) indicates it would take 1.0 years of cash flow to repay all financial debt. This short period demonstrates excellent debt sustainability. Cash flow represents 5.0% of revenue. Cash flow measures resources generated by operations, available for investment and debt repayment. Satisfactory level allowing partial financing of growth.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ms
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 49 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 27 days. The company must finance 22 days of gap between collections and payments. Inventory turnover is 1 days (= Average inventory / Cost of goods x 360). Fast turnover, sign of good inventory management. Overall, WCR represents 49 days of revenue, i.e. 6.2 M€ to permanently finance. Notable WCR improvement over the period (-36%), freeing up cash.
